A rezone request for a mixed-use project that was split to only approve the commercial portion.
The commercial portion can proceed, but the residential townhome portion is delayed.

A local business owner suggested that the city's three-year utility deposit requirement is too long and hurts small businesses.
The city is looking to change the minimum area required for agriculture protection zones. This could affect future land use decisions related to farming and open space.
Residents and Council members are debating the fairness of the new tiered water rates, with some arguing it unfairly penalizes owners of larger lots.
A resident is calling for the city to hire a dedicated ADA coordinator to ensure compliance with federal law.
